OFFICE SECRETARY III

The State of Maryland is seeking an Office Secretary III for the Department of Assessments and Taxation, Real Property Division. This role provides advanced clerical and administrative support, managing correspondence, responding to public inquiries, and maintaining confidential records to ensure efficient property assessment services for Maryland residents.

Responsibilities

To provide advanced clerical and administrative support as a Secretary III within the Anne Arundel Assessments Office
This position is responsible for independently managing correspondence, responding to public inquiries, maintaining confidential records, and preparing documents related to assessment and exemption processes
The role ensures accurate and timely processing of information and supports the daily operations of the office, contributing directly to the agency’s mission of delivering fair, efficient, and accessible property assessment services to Maryland residents

Required

Graduation from an accredited high school or possession of a high school equivalency certificate
Three years performing secretarial or clerical work involving typing duties
Demonstrated ability to accurately type on a keyboard of a personal computer at a minimum of forty words per minute may be required, depending on the specific requirements of the position

Preferred

Experience managing a high-volume workload and successfully prioritizing tasks to meet strict deadlines
Demonstrated ability to coordinate multiple assignments or competing priorities with minimal supervision
Experience handling confidential or sensitive information in compliance with state, agency, or legal requirements
Ability to maintain discretion and follow established protocols when working with confidential records
Experience organizing and maintaining paper and electronic filing systems to ensure information is accurate, accessible, and secure
Experience using office software tools such as Microsoft Office, shared drives, or database systems to track, store, and retrieve files
Demonstrated accuracy and attention to detail in preparing correspondence, entering data, or reviewing documents
Proven ability to proofread, verify information, and check work for errors prior to submission

Benefits

Health insurance
Dental, and vision plans offered at a low cost
Personal Leave - new State employees are awarded six (6) personnel days annually (prorated based on start date)
Annual Leave - ten (10) days of accumulated annual leave per year
Sick Leave - fifteen (15) days of accumulated sick leave per year
Parental Leave - up to sixty (60) days of paid parental leave upon the birth or adoption of a child
Holidays - State employees also celebrate at least twelve (12) holidays per year
Pension - State employees earn credit towards a retirement pension
